Deborah L. Blake is a scholar working on Molecular Biology, Genetics and Pediatrics, Perinatology and Child Health. According to data from OpenAlex, Deborah L. Blake has authored 5 papers receiving a total of 376 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 2 papers in Genetics and 2 papers in Pediatrics, Perinatology and Child Health. Recurrent topics in Deborah L. Blake's work include Nuclear Structure and Function (3 papers), Neurogenetic and Muscular Disorders Research (2 papers) and Prenatal Screening and Diagnostics (2 papers). Deborah L. Blake is often cited by papers focused on Nuclear Structure and Function (3 papers), Neurogenetic and Muscular Disorders Research (2 papers) and Prenatal Screening and Diagnostics (2 papers). Deborah L. Blake collaborates with scholars based in Canada, France and United States. Deborah L. Blake's co-authors include Micheline Paulin‐Levasseur, Michael W. McBurney, Howard J. Worman, Isabelle Callebaut, Ilona S. Skerjanc, Feng Lin, Lars E. Holmer, Nicola Dean, Asangla Ao and Seang Lin Tan and has published in prestigious journals such as Journal of Biological Chemistry, Chromosoma and Molecular Human Reproduction.
